"Tavern on the Park is a Downtown Chicago restaurant that overlooks Millennium Park. It was targeted after switching to Reserve in June 2017. The restaurant was previously using OpenTable since its opening in 2007. Co-owner Peter de Castro expressed frustration over the undermining tactics that affected their business, particularly with the series of no-show reservations that began in December and increased over time. These no-shows coincided with inquiries from OpenTable about Tavern's sales and attempts to convince them to switch back to their service." - Ashok Selvam

Spiaggia

Italian restaurant · Gold Coast

"We’ve made the difficult decision not to re-open Spiaggia and Café Spiaggia. We were very much looking forward to welcoming back our family and guests. Unfortunately, we were unsuccessful in our efforts to restructure our lease, which was necessary to reflect the realities of operating a restaurant in an office building, post-pandemic. It’s been an incredible journey, and we are beyond proud of, and grateful for, 37 remarkable years. From the moment we envisioned the restaurants, our passion has been to elevate fine dining Italian cuisine. The endless number of special occasions, the most passionate staff and the amazing talent still delighting guests around the country, will remind us that Spiaggia and Café Spiaggia will live forever."
